I'm pleased and proud to accept the offer to be an attending professional at Dragoncon this year. This will be my first DragonCon. I've always heard nothing but the most glowing reports, and I know many people who will be there this year. I look forward to it, and I'm more than happy to help.
I have committed to four conventions so far for 2017:
Ravencon in Williamsburg, Va. April 28-30
Soonercon in Oklahoma City June 23-25
Libertycon in Chattanooga June 30-July 2
Dragoncon in Atlanta Sept. 1-4
